Warrior Poet

The skies above me burn tonight,
just as my blood did, during the fight
that started with the rising sun,
where we stood our ground, until we won.

The ground beneath my boots shook then,
from pounding hearts and the wars of men,
Fear arose in my aching throat,
that coppery taste of which the poet wrote,
but tempered with resolve, for this I knew:
that I’m the best at what I do.

Faster friend, or fiercer foe,
which would you have, in the afterglow,
as the sun sets upon a day of swords,
and I take time to forge these words?

The night-breeze whispers, soft, serene
belying the truth of this battle scene,
for tomorrow’s dawn shall come once more,
as The Poet pauses, and trades words for war.

© 05-10-04 by JSR

May 12, 2004

Running For Others

Read: Philippians 2:1-11

Let nothing be done through selfish ambition or conceit, but . . . let each esteem others better than himself. —Philippians 2:3

Bible In One Year: 2 Kings 15-16; John 3:1-18


Tom Knapp never won a race during his entire high school track career. Tom was a "pusher." It was his task to set the pace for his fellow team members, who would then beat him to the finish line. When he ran a successful race, he was enabling a fellow teammate to win. Even though Tom never had enough reserve energy for the final sprint to victory, the coach considered him a valuable member of the team.

In a similar way, the New Testament tells us to run our race of faith with the success of others in mind. "Let nothing be done through selfish ambition or conceit, but in lowliness of mind let each esteem others better than himself. Let each of you look out not only for his own interests, but also for the interests of others" (Philippians 2:3-4). Our example of such living is Jesus Christ, who left the glory of heaven to share our humanity and die on the cross so that we can have eternal life (vv.5-8).

If the encouragement of our example helps another person to flourish and be successful, we should rejoice. When the eternal prizes are awarded for faithful service to God, a lot of "pushers" will be wearing blue ribbons. Until then, let's keep running so that others can win. —David McCasland

Oh, to see the needs of others
More important than our own,
Following our Lord's example
When He left His heavenly throne. —Sper

You can't lose when you help others win.
